Fire Engineer I

 

 

 

The City of Orangeburg is seeking individuals to fill vacancies as Fire Engineers with the Orangeburg Department of Public Safety.

 

 

General Purpose

 

Performs general fire department duties for the protection of life and property within the department’s fire service district. Duties includes, but are not limited to, driving and operating various fire apparatus, fire suppression, fire cause determination, fire-ground traffic regulation, fire prevention and public fire education activities. Duties are diverse and discretionary and require judgment in the broad application of policies and procedures.

 

Supervision Received

 

Works under the general supervision of a Public Safety Officer III (Corporal).

 

 

Essential Job Duties

 

  • Respond to fires and other emergency situations to protect and save life and property;

  • Operate fire apparatus, perform fire suppression duties, and extrication;

  • Prepare incident reports;

  • Participate in training exercises and continuing education classes as assigned;

  • Present public education and awareness programs regarding fire prevention;

  • Perform various station duties and maintenance as required;

  • Assist with annual certification testing of equipment; and

  • Perform all other duties as assigned.

 

Minimum Requirements

 

  • Must be 18 years of age or older;

  • Possess a valid South Carolina driver’s license;

  • Possess a High School Diploma or equivalent;

  • Ability to meet the requirements of the SC Fire Academy;

  • Must provide a recent Credit Report;

  • Must pass a criminal background check and driver's license record check;

  • Must be able to successfully complete medical examination and drug screening;

  • Must be able to successfully complete psychological and polygraph examinations;

  • Must be able to successfully complete physical and written assessments; and

  • Good Moral Character.

 

 

Necessary Knowledge, Skills and Abilities:

 

  • Some knowledge of modern fire suppression principals, procedures, techniques and equipment;

  • Some skill in operating a wide variety of tools and equipment;

  • Ability to learn and effectively apply the ordinances department rules and regulations;

  • Ability to perform work requiring good physical condition;

  • Ability to communicate effectively orally and in writing; ability to establish and maintain effective working relationships with subordinates, peers and supervisors;

  • Ability to exercise sound judgment in evaluating situations and in make decisions with limited supervision or guidance; ability to follow verbal and written instructions;

  • Ability to learn fire district’s geography; ability to perform strenuous or peak physical efforts during emergency or training activities for prolonged periods of time under conditions of extreme height, intense heat, cold or smoke; ability to meet the special requirement listed below

 

Special Requirements

 

  • Must possess a valid State Driver’s License without record of suspension or revocation in any state;

  • Ability to meet department’s physical fitness standard;

 

 

Preferred Qualifications

 

Currently certified IFSTA Firefighter II.

This exam is 155 questions over a 2.5 hour time frame. It is broken into 2 parts with an 105 question cognitive exam and a 50 question integrity exam. The exam does require a 70 overall with a required minimum of 75 of the integrity to pass. The test and study guide material are solely owned by IO Solutions. Any cost associated with study material is the responsibility of the applicant.
